This specific file is a custom recovery image for the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 series (GT-P3100, GT-P3110, GT-P5100, GT-P5110). TWRP, or Team Win Recovery Project, is an open-source recovery image that provides a touchscreen-enabled interface, allowing you to perform advanced functions not possible with the stock recovery, such as installing custom ROMs and creating full system backups.
